Introduction(2/3) This scheme creates unbalanced MD streams by adjusting the frame rate, quantization or spatial resolution of each stream and can achieve unbalanced rates of up to 2:1. Their results show that unbalanced MDC scheme provides improved reliability over multiple paths with unequal bandwidths. Introduction(3/3) In [5], an MDC system for multi–hop networks is proposed. The application and network layers cooperate to provide more robustness against severe network conditions. The authors propose a multi–path selection method that chooses a set of paths to achieve more robust media transmission.
